About the PDF Reader
Our free online PDF reader lets you view and navigate PDF documents directly in your browser without installing any software. Upload any PDF and instantly browse through pages with intuitive navigation controls, zoom in/out for comfortable reading, and jump to specific pages. Unlike desktop PDF readers that require downloads and installations, our browser-based reader works on any device — Windows, Mac, Linux, Chromebook, tablet, or phone.
The reader uses PDF.js, the same powerful PDF rendering engine used by Mozilla Firefox, to render PDFs with crisp text, embedded images, and vector graphics. You can navigate page by page, jump directly to any page number, and adjust the zoom level from 50% to 200% for optimal reading comfort. Keyboard shortcuts (arrow keys) let you flip through pages quickly without reaching for your mouse.
All processing happens in your browser — your PDF never leaves your device, ensuring complete privacy. This makes it ideal for viewing sensitive documents like financial statements, legal contracts, or personal records that you don't want to upload to third-party services.
How to Use the PDF Reader
- Upload — Click the upload area or drag and drop a PDF file to load it into the reader.
- Navigate — Use the Previous/Next buttons, First/Last buttons, or type a page number to jump to a specific page.
- Zoom — Adjust the zoom level from 50% to 200% for comfortable reading at any screen size.
- Keyboard Shortcuts — Use Left/Right arrow keys or Up/Down arrow keys to flip between pages.
